stringtranslate.com

Investigación Unix

Research Unix son las primeras versiones del sistema operativo Unix para computadoras DEC PDP-7 , PDP-11 , VAX e Interdata 7/32 y 8/32 , desarrolladas en el Centro de Investigación en Ciencias de la Computación de Bell Labs (CSRC).

Historia

Versión 7 de Unix para PDP-11 , ejecutándose en SIMH

El término Research Unix apareció por primera vez en el Bell System Technical Journal (Vol. 57, No. 6, Parte 2 julio/agosto de 1978) para distinguirlo de otras versiones internas de Bell Labs (como PWB/UNIX y MERT ) cuyo código base había divergido de la versión CSRC primaria. Sin embargo, ese término se usó poco hasta la Versión 8 de Unix , pero se ha aplicado retroactivamente también a versiones anteriores. Antes de la V8, el sistema operativo se llamaba simplemente UNIX (en mayúsculas) o el Sistema de tiempo compartido UNIX.

AT&T licenció la versión 5 a instituciones educativas, y la versión 6 también a sitios comerciales. Las escuelas pagaron 200 dólares y otras 20.000, desalentando la mayoría del uso comercial, pero la versión 6 fue la versión más utilizada hasta la década de 1980. Las versiones de Research Unix suelen mencionarse por la edición del manual que las describe, [1] porque las primeras versiones y las últimas nunca se lanzaron oficialmente fuera de Bell Labs, y crecieron orgánicamente. Por lo tanto, el primer Research Unix sería la Primera Edición, y el último la Décima Edición. Otra forma común de referirse a ellos es como "Versión x Unix" o "V x Unix", donde x es la edición del manual. Todas las ediciones modernas de Unix, excepto las implementaciones similares a Unix como Coherent , Minix y Linux, derivan de la Séptima Edición. [ cita requerida ]

A partir de la 8.ª edición, las versiones de Research Unix tenían una relación estrecha con BSD . Esto comenzó con el uso de 4.1cBSD como base para la 8.ª edición. En una publicación de Usenet de 2000, Dennis Ritchie describió estas versiones posteriores de Research Unix como más cercanas a BSD que a UNIX System V , [2] que también incluía algo de código BSD: [1]

Research Unix 8th Edition comenzó con (creo) BSD 4.1c, pero con enormes cantidades extraídas y reemplazadas por nuestro propio material. Esto continuó con las versiones 9 y 10. El conjunto de comandos de usuario normal tenía, supongo, un poco más de sabor a BSD que a SysVish, pero era bastante ecléctico.

Versiones

Legado

En 2002, Caldera International lanzó [12] Unix V1, V2, V3, V4, V5, V6 , V7 en PDP-11 y Unix 32V en VAX como FOSS bajo una licencia de software permisiva similar a BSD . [13] [14] [15]

En 2017, Unix Heritage Society y Alcatel-Lucent USA Inc., en su propio nombre y en el de Nokia Bell Laboratories , lanzaron V8, V9 y V10 con la condición de que solo se permitiera el uso no comercial y de que no presentarían reclamos de derechos de autor contra dicho uso. [16]

Véase también

Referencias

  1. ^ abcd Fiedler, Ryan (octubre de 1983). "El tutorial de Unix / Parte 3: Unix en el mercado de los microordenadores". BYTE . p. 132 . Consultado el 30 de enero de 2015 .
  2. ^ Ritchie, Dennis (26 de octubre de 2000). «alt.folklore.computers: BSD (Dennis Ritchie)» . Consultado el 3 de julio de 2014 .
  3. ^ abcdefghijk McIlroy, MD (1987). Un lector de Unix para investigación: extractos anotados del Manual del programador, 1971–1986 (PDF) (Informe técnico). CSTR. Bell Labs. 139.
  4. ^ ab Thompson, Ken; Ritchie, Dennis M. (12 de junio de 1972). Manual del programador de UNIX, segunda edición (PDF) . Bell Telephone Laboratories. Archivado desde el original (PDF) el 6 de octubre de 2016.
  5. ^ Ritchie, DM; Thompson, K. (1974). "El sistema de tiempo compartido de UNIX". Comunicaciones de la ACM . 17 (7): 365–375. doi : 10.1145/361011.361061 . S2CID  53235982.
  6. ^ abc Ritchie, Dennis (27 de junio de 2003). "[TUHS] Re: V7 UNIX en VAX 11/750". minnie.tuhs.org . Archivado desde el original el 2017-03-05 . Consultado el 9 de abril de 2014 .
  7. ^ "csh". The Unix Heritage Society . nd . Consultado el 19 de diciembre de 2022 .
  8. ^ Spencer, Henry (1986-01-19). "regexp(3)". Grupo de noticias : mod.sources. Usenet:  [email protected] . Consultado el 9 de enero de 2013 .
  9. ^ Presotto, David L.; Ritchie, Dennis M. (1990). "Comunicación entre procesos en el sistema Unix de novena edición". Software: práctica y experiencia . 19 .
  10. ^ "Manual de Unix Décima Edición". Bell Labs . Archivado desde el original el 3 de febrero de 2015. Consultado el 25 de diciembre de 2013 .
  11. ^ "El sistema UNIX multinivel seguro IX".
  12. ^ Caldera publica UNIX originales bajo licencia BSD en slashdot.org (2002)
  13. ^ "¡UNIX es libre!". lemis.com. 24 de enero de 2002.
  14. ^ Broderick, Bill (23 de enero de 2002). "Queridos entusiastas de Unix" (PDF) . Caldera International . Archivado desde el original (PDF) el 19 de febrero de 2009.
  15. ^ Darwin, Ian F. (3 de febrero de 2002). "Por qué Caldera lanzó Unix: una breve historia". Linuxdevcenter . O'Reilly Media . Archivado desde el original el 1 de junio de 2004 . Consultado el 18 de enero de 2022 .
  16. ^ No más Samizdat: código fuente antiguo de Unix abierto para estudio por Richard Chirgwin en register.com (30 de marzo de 2017)

Enlaces externos